Duties include but are not limited to

  • Contract Management: Administering contracts including modifications change orders contract renewals extensions and closeouts by ensuring completeness and compliance

  • Small Purchasing: Coordinate with agencies to procure goods and services under the single quote threshold and to conduct request for quotes.

  • Solicitation Development: Managing preparation and processing of solicitations such as invitation for bids request for information request for proposals request for quotes and request for qualifications

  • Compliance and Review:Reviewing documents for accuracy completeness and compliance with laws policies and procedures for cooperative procurements request for quotes sole source procurements demand and emergency payments and other types of procurements as assigned

  • Customer Support: Providing consultation to City agencies and departments; Performing additional duties as assigned such as collaborating with the Office of Minority Business Development records administration managing expenditures supporting the Procurement Purchasing Card Program and responding to audit questions; Developing productive business relationships with various City agencies Identifying strategic sourcing opportunities to reduce overall costs

  • Innovation: Actively participating in activities and functions that contribute to professional development; Providing suggestions to improve department processes





Qualifications Special Certifications and Licenses

KNOWLEDGE SKILLS AND ABILITIES:
Technical Knowledge and Experience:

  • In-depth understanding of public purchasing and procurement practices including contract management and administration
  • Familiarity with Virginia and City of Richmond procurement codes as well as federal state and local acquisition regulations.
  • Foundational knowledge in business law finance budgeting accounting supply chain and quantitative methods
Technology Proficiency:
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word Excel PowerPoint).
  • Experience using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) software SharePoint and electronic procurement systems.
  • Working knowledge of reporting tools (e.g. EIS) automated financial systems procurement e-business tools (such as Procurement and Payables Inquiry Models) and scheduling software.
Communication and Interpersonal Skills:
  • Strong business writing and verbal communication skills.
  • Skilled in negotiating pricing terms and contract conditions.
  • Proven ability to build and maintain professional relationships with diverse stakeholders.
  • Comfortable interacting with individuals from varied professional and cultural backgrounds.
Attention to Detail and Organizational Skills:
  • Highly attentive to detail and accuracy particularly in document review and procurement processes.
  • Capable of managing multiple tasks simultaneously in a fast-paced environment.
  • Experienced in proofreading analyzing acquisition requirements and evaluating contractor capabilities.
MINIMUM TRAINING AND EXPERIENCE:
  • Bachelors degree in accounting business administration finance or directly related field
  • Two years of professional procurement experience involving the purchase of goods and services
  • An equivalent combination of training and experience (as approved by the department) may be used to meet the minimum qualifications of the classification.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Intermediate to advanced MS Word and/or MS Excel skills.
  • Experience with Oracle ERP and/or OpenGov.
  • Certification in public procurement (e.g. VCA VCO CPPB CPPO NIGP-CPP)
